Cloud migration: the first steps

  There are many indications that cloud migration is inevitable for numerous enterprises. Reports state that the cloud-migration market is expected to be worth more than $462 billion as early as 2027. In the age of cloud culture, as more companies decide to move at least some processes to cloud infrastructure, migration may accelerate considerably. Several key factors must be considered to prepare a company for cloud migration effectively. The first step should be to define migration objectives and strategy. Above all, the company should identify why applications are being moved to the cloud and define the business objectives this will make achievable. On this basis, it can develop a schedule, priorities, and the resources required for successful implementation. The next step should be to appoint a team responsible for cloud migration. It should include representatives of different departments, such as IT, security, and finance, but it is also advisable to involve rank-and-file employees who will use the cloud. Even before selecting the right technology, the workforce should be prepared for a change in working practices and for operating in the cloud. Employees should have the appropriate skills and technical knowledge to manage the cloud and use its capabilities effectively. They should also understand the migration objectives.    

Analyzing and qualifying applications for cloud migration

  The next step in cloud migration is to analyze and qualify the applications used by the company. To migrate a system to the cloud successfully, the organization must understand the associated limitations and risks, so an assessment of the existing infrastructure should begin the technical part of the process. A thorough assessment of the current infrastructure, including servers, networks, and operating systems, makes it possible to identify the most important applications and determine their resource requirements. An analysis of the costs associated with maintaining and expanding the existing infrastructure and with the migration process itself is just as important as qualifying applications for cloud migration. Costs to consider in this case include:
  • purchasing hardware,
  • software licenses,
  • maintenance,
  • scaling,
  • security.
This provides a basis for assessing whether cloud migration is more economical than maintaining proprietary infrastructure. However, a report prepared by McKinsey shows that only 7% of organizations used their own resources in 2020, indicating that companies perceive cloud migration as financially beneficial. At this stage, it is also worth evaluating cloud functionality and analyzing which features and services offered by cloud providers meet the needs of the applications used by the company. Important considerations include scalability, availability, security, and management. The organization should also verify whether the cloud provider supports the application’s specific requirements.    

Preparing the right architecture for a cloud environment

  Preparing the right cloud-environment architecture is crucial to ensuring efficient and scalable cloud infrastructure. This requires an analysis of the cloud services available from providers. The assessment should consider services such as virtual servers, databases, and data analytics. Based on this analysis, the organization should select the provider that best meets its requirements. It is worth considering a multilayer architecture in which the application is divided into presentation, business-logic, and data layers. Where possible, a microservices architecture should also be considered. The application’s scalability and flexibility requirements must be taken into account. Using cloud features such as load balancing and containers will ensure high availability. Designing a cloud architecture that uses resources flexibly and scales them according to demand helps avoid wasting resources. Mechanisms such as backups, data replication, and disaster-recovery plans must also be addressed. These will strengthen security and protect the company against data loss.    

Security and data protection during cloud migration

  Ensuring security and data protection is a key consideration during cloud migration. The company should use data-encryption mechanisms both when transferring data to the cloud and while the data is at rest. Selecting a provider that offers strong encryption methods, such as the SSL/TLS protocol for network communications and data-encryption algorithms, supports this objective. Network-security features such as network firewalls and Network Access Control should also be used. Once migration to the cloud is complete, the organization should create unique user accounts, apply authorization policies, and assign access permissions according to the principle of least privilege to control access to data effectively. Mechanisms for auditing and monitoring cloud activity are also essential. Using cloud tools to record events, analyze logs, and generate alerts in response to suspicious activity is important for strengthening data security. Penetration testing and vulnerability assessments are also advisable. They make it possible to identify potential security gaps.    

What else should be considered during cloud migration?

  Responsibility for cloud migration rests not only with the company moving its infrastructure to cloud technology, but also with its providers. The company should make sure that its provider holds the appropriate certificates and that the solutions it uses comply with legal requirements and industry regulations. Particular attention should be paid to how data is protected and to compliance with regulatory requirements such as the GDPR. A cloud-data backup strategy and a disaster-recovery plan must also be planned and implemented. Every company using the cloud should have mechanisms for creating regular backups. It should also test its recovery process regularly to ensure that data can be restored after a failure. Beyond technical matters, training that raises employees’ awareness of cloud security is equally important. Training the team in best practices, the handling of confidential data, and guidelines for using cloud services is often more important than even the best technical safeguards. Before signing an SLA with a cloud provider, the company must also ensure that it covers security, data protection, and the provider’s liability in the event of a security breach. This provides legal protection and makes it possible to pursue potential claims in the event of a serious failure.
